How Pipe17 Valuation is Determined
Private company valuations like Pipe17's are determined through primary funding rounds led by venture capital firms, private equity investors, and strategic partners. The valuation reflects factors including:
- Revenue growth and financial performance
- Market opportunity and total addressable market (TAM)
- Competitive positioning and market share
- Management team strength and execution capability
- Technology and intellectual property
- Industry trends and investor sentiment
